Crypto: $ 13.5 billion in burnt Ethereum, but the offer continues to climb

While we often praise Ethereum as an asset potentially deflationary, the reality of the protocol tells another story. Nearly 4.6 million ETH have been burned since 2021, the equivalent of $ 13.5 billion, without stopping the growth of the offer. An anomaly that questions the consistency and efficiency of the economic model implemented since the London update, and calls into question certain certainties on the programmed rarity of the assets.

A massive burn mechanism, but a limited effect on the offer

Since the implementation of the EIP-1559 on August 5, 2021, the Ethereum network has introduced a major monetary novelty: the automatic destruction of a portion of transaction costs, or “Burn”intended to reduce inflationary pressure on ETH's offer, while crypto has just crossed $ 3,000.

In 1,438 days, This mechanism brought to burn 4.6 million Ethor about $ 13.57 billion at the current market value. This represents an average of 2.22 ETH burned each minute, and this figure remains strongly correlated in terms of activity on the blockchain.

The applications and uses responsible for the majority of burnt ETH are well identified. Here are the main contributors, according to Ultrasound.Money data ::

  • Classic ETH transactions: 375 959 ETH burns;
  • OPENSEA (NFT): 230 051 ETH sent to Burn;
  • The Uniswap V2 (DEX): 227,045 ETH destroyed;
  • TETHER transfers (USDT): 210,070 ETH burnt.

This monetary mechanism, praised for its transparency and simplicity, does not however manage to compensate for the quantity of newly issued ETH. The burn depends closely on the level of use of the network: the more transactions, the more the quantity of destroyed eTh increases.

Conversely, during the lower activity period, mechanics shows its limits. The expected effect, reducing the global supply, therefore remains partially neutralized by a broadcast even greater than Burn Total since 2021.

Moderate, but persistent inflation: the paradox of Ethereum

Despite this massive destruction, the Ethereum network continues to emit more eTh than it burns. Thus, 3,695,537 ETH have been created from Hard Fork London, injecting approximately $ 10.89 billion of additional value in the ecosystem.

The rate of annual median inflation over the period reached 0.801 %, an almost equivalent level to that of bitcoin today (0.809 %)although clearly decreases compared to the old model of proof-of-work of Ethereum, which would have generated an inflation of 3.394 %.

This discrepancy between burn and monetary creation reveals a policy in unstable balance. The most recent weekly data, however, show a slight inflection: over seven days, the emission rate fell to 0.723 %, with 16,745 ETH newly created.

This development seems to be linked to a drop in network activity, and therefore to a lower pressure on burn. Contrary to the received idea according to which Ethereum is becoming “Deflationist”the reality is much more nuanced. The balance between burn and creation strongly depends on the volume of transactions and the use of the network by decentralized applications.

In the short term, this controlled inflation can appear as a viable compromise, guaranteeing sufficient incentives for validators while limiting dilution for holders. However, in the longer term, the maintenance of an inflationary offer, even moderate, could be problematic if the burn fails to keep the pace in times of low activity. It remains to be seen whether the protocol will be led to adjust its economic parameters or if it counts on the organic growth of the ecosystem to sustainably reverse the trend.
